Output ea177f633103c58e389592dc4cdcc416657d9ce8fe52f2d0a2916482ecc2124f:4

value
602582
script pubkey
OP_0 OP_PUSHBYTES_20 9fbd3d5b95d181893a190fd599ae10401398045f
address
bc1qn77n6ku46xqcjwsepl2entssgqfespzlhdja2v
transaction
ea177f633103c58e389592dc4cdcc416657d9ce8fe52f2d0a2916482ecc2124f